Cadastral Non-Conformity
Property mapped differently from reality

Rooms that legally don't exist, extensions never registered, internal layouts that don't match the records. We correct, regularise and make the property saleable.

Planning Irregularities
Built without permit or outside the permit

We assess whether amnesty (sanatoria) applies, prepare and submit the full package, and resolve the irregularity with the relevant municipality.

Change of Use
Agricultural or commercial to residential

Converting a barn, agricultural outbuilding or commercial space into a legal residential property requires specific permits. We manage the full procedure.
